Most popular form of entertainment in Ancient Rome.
Admired by men and adored by women, gladiators were trained fighters who entertained the crowds in Ancient Rome.

Most gladiators were slaves or prisoners, even criminals but there were also ordinary people who chose to become gladiators.
Adopted from the earlier Etruscans.
